Kesar The International School, a CBSE school in Bangalore, is hiring a Student Counsellor.
Key responsibilities:
- Provide one-on-one and group support to students
- Coordinate with parents, teachers and external specialists
- Maintain confidential case records
- Support inclusion and wellbeing initiatives
Requirements:
- 2-6 years of relevant experience
- Degree in Psychology / Social Work / Special Education as relevant
About the school: Kesar The International School is a CBSE Day School in Vidyanagar, Bangalore.
What you'll handle as a Student Counsellor — Kesar The International School
Run individual and group counselling, screen for socio-emotional concerns, support career guidance and partner with parents on student wellbeing.
